New package, as Heaven requested in bug #160773.
authorVlastimil Babka <caster@gentoo.org>
Sun, 7 Jan 2007 22:46:29 +0000 (22:46 +0000)
committerVlastimil Babka <caster@gentoo.org>
Sun, 7 Jan 2007 22:46:29 +0000 (22:46 +0000)
Package-Manager: portage-2.1.2_rc4-r5

dev-java/higlayout/ChangeLog [new file with mode: 0644]
dev-java/higlayout/Manifest [new file with mode: 0644]
dev-java/higlayout/files/digest-higlayout-1.0 [new file with mode: 0644]
dev-java/higlayout/higlayout-1.0.ebuild [new file with mode: 0644]
dev-java/higlayout/metadata.xml [new file with mode: 0644]

diff --git a/dev-java/higlayout/ChangeLog b/dev-java/higlayout/ChangeLog
new file mode 100644 (file)
index 0000000..0c04cd8
--- /dev/null
@@ -0,0 +1,10 @@
+# ChangeLog for dev-java/higlayout
+#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-java/higlayout/ChangeLog,v 1.1 2007/01/07 22:46:29 caster Exp $
+
+*higlayout-1.0 (07 Jan 2007)
+
+  07 Jan 2007; Vlastimil Babka <caster@gentoo.org> +metadata.xml,
+  +higlayout-1.0.ebuild:
+  New package, as Heaven requested in bug #160773.
+
diff --git a/dev-java/higlayout/Manifest b/dev-java/higlayout/Manifest
new file mode 100644 (file)
index 0000000..072b9f4
--- /dev/null
@@ -0,0 +1,16 @@
+DIST HIGLayout1.0.zip 78855 RMD160 c0b447b8176d3d3cb0f54a2be3c3511eb3db9a51 SHA1 e2504312bf478d95aa131343115c85766d186355 SHA256 87464c9c889c7f5c94170ccb76ec088b1452897f670dab090ff3db06c3fed5e7
+EBUILD higlayout-1.0.ebuild 1291 RMD160 1ca6dfc9ec271ddbfa263b7f99934200058f9434 SHA1 f570f822720f6280924c4da27da2aebf93077348 SHA256 598ebbe8286268c8109b7cf57820ed0722ee0784ea3103c1994778eec36b762d
+MD5 411c15fb0fb6ac8dd2dc448cfb11018f higlayout-1.0.ebuild 1291
+RMD160 1ca6dfc9ec271ddbfa263b7f99934200058f9434 higlayout-1.0.ebuild 1291
+SHA256 598ebbe8286268c8109b7cf57820ed0722ee0784ea3103c1994778eec36b762d higlayout-1.0.ebuild 1291
+MISC ChangeLog 382 RMD160 d18efbc4b2c9f15f2ab1fe406d94ce999f9765ba SHA1 07429ef70ef8ae68e32a20b871c78aa2e7a358a5 SHA256 086a6992475fd3ed5d0dab3ed660cd63e71855e53dc9e7c8e26f5892068a31b7
+MD5 31ca9baf04642e2ce12b96ab00a6a69c ChangeLog 382
+RMD160 d18efbc4b2c9f15f2ab1fe406d94ce999f9765ba ChangeLog 382
+SHA256 086a6992475fd3ed5d0dab3ed660cd63e71855e53dc9e7c8e26f5892068a31b7 ChangeLog 382
+MISC metadata.xml 158 RMD160 493079b5fb71d66863beea1b023901c90ba81be5 SHA1 77cd509a8b3c377b9a24480b48a5d5481b7874f1 SHA256 ea882ceccfd160b16cf7e79de423bdcc12b3fa000f124491a6df36f5783894fb
+MD5 123cf9440c1d4ac78f2caba1624765f9 metadata.xml 158
+RMD160 493079b5fb71d66863beea1b023901c90ba81be5 metadata.xml 158
+SHA256 ea882ceccfd160b16cf7e79de423bdcc12b3fa000f124491a6df36f5783894fb metadata.xml 158
+MD5 f6358d6cf03c7a5ea7ce960aa6b3b293 files/digest-higlayout-1.0 226
+RMD160 61633ea63608925e3f863cbabe083ceef7508a87 files/digest-higlayout-1.0 226
+SHA256 032d67914cedb7cbb88581a562b839a748fdec3e3fcb529303d3155cedb21792 files/digest-higlayout-1.0 226
diff --git a/dev-java/higlayout/files/digest-higlayout-1.0 b/dev-java/higlayout/files/digest-higlayout-1.0
new file mode 100644 (file)
index 0000000..809cf49
--- /dev/null
@@ -0,0 +1,3 @@
+MD5 5bd79f33157824499b0fc03d6a5e080a HIGLayout1.0.zip 78855
+RMD160 c0b447b8176d3d3cb0f54a2be3c3511eb3db9a51 HIGLayout1.0.zip 78855
+SHA256 87464c9c889c7f5c94170ccb76ec088b1452897f670dab090ff3db06c3fed5e7 HIGLayout1.0.zip 78855
diff --git a/dev-java/higlayout/higlayout-1.0.ebuild b/dev-java/higlayout/higlayout-1.0.ebuild
new file mode 100644 (file)
index 0000000..4b292cb
--- /dev/null
@@ -0,0 +1,56 @@
+# Copyright 1999-2007 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-java/higlayout/higlayout-1.0.ebuild,v 1.1 2007/01/07 22:46:29 caster Exp $
+
+inherit java-pkg-2
+
+DESCRIPTION="Java Swing layout manager that's powerful and easy to use"
+
+HOMEPAGE="http://www.autel.cz/dmi/tutorial.html"
+SRC_URI="http://www.autel.cz/dmi/HIGLayout${PV}.zip"
+LICENSE="LGPL-2.1"
+SLOT="0"
+KEYWORDS="x86"
+IUSE="doc examples source"
+DEPEND=">=virtual/jdk-1.4
+       app-arch/unzip
+       source? ( app-arch/zip )"
+RDEPEND=">=virtual/jre-1.4"
+
+S="${WORKDIR}"
+
+src_unpack() {
+       unpack ${A}
+       cd "${S}"
+
+       mkdir classes api
+       cd tutorial
+       for d in *.GIF;
+       do
+               mv $d $(basename $d .GIF).gif
+       done
+}
+
+src_compile() {
+       ejavac -d classes src/cz/autel/dmi/*.java || die "failed to compile sources"
+       jar cf higlayout.jar classes/cz || die "failed to create .jar"
+       if use doc; then
+               javadoc -author -version -d api src/cz/autel/dmi/*.java \
+                       || die "javadoc failed"
+       fi
+}
+
+src_install() {
+       java-pkg_dojar ${PN}.jar
+       dodoc *.txt
+       if use doc; then
+               dohtml -r tutorial
+               java-pkg_dojavadoc api
+       fi
+       if use examples; then
+               dodir /usr/share/doc/${PF}/examples
+               insinto /usr/share/doc/${PF}/examples
+               doins examples/*
+       fi
+       use source && java-pkg_dosrc src/cz
+}
diff --git a/dev-java/higlayout/metadata.xml b/dev-java/higlayout/metadata.xml
new file mode 100644 (file)
index 0000000..7303cef
--- /dev/null
@@ -0,0 +1,5 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+       <herd>java</herd>
+</pkgmetadata>